Artist To Transform Aging LA Hotel Into Temporary Work Of Art

LOS ANGELES (AP) — Its days may be numbered but it looks as if LA's seedy, long-abandoned Sunset Pacific Hotel may be going out in style.

French artist Vincent Lamouroux says he plans to turn the building, once a haven for drug dealers and prostitutes, into an "iconic piece of LA's architectural history."

But only for a couple weeks.

Beginning April 20 the artist plans to bathe the aging Sunset Boulevard structure and its surrounding trees in white lime paint.

The work, titled "Projection," will be unveiled April 26.

For the next two weeks it will anchor arts education programs in conjunction with local schools.

Then its paint is expected to fade, returning it to original form.

A September hearing will determine whether the building, an eyesore in a gentrifying neighborhood, is torn down.
